Propagation effects in apertureless near-field optical antennas

Kanglin Wang, Adrian Barkan, and Daniel M. Mittleman

We report a direct observation of the electromagnetic wave propagation on optical antennas. A free-space broadband terahertz pulse is coupled into a propagating mode along the shaft of an optical antenna acting as an apertureless near-field probe. We determine the spatial extent of this guided mode and its velocity. In addition, we consider the possibility of multiply reflected modes propagating along the near-field probe, an effect which will be significant in near-field spectroscopic measurements. © 2004 American Institute of Physics.
